MAIN Hedge Fund Activity: Q4 2022 in Review

273 of the 6,221 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Main Street Capital (MAIN) for Q4 2022, worth a combined $864M — up 76% from $491M a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 50 funds opened new MAIN positions and 20 closed out — a net gain of 30 holders — while 112 added to existing stakes and 58 trimmed.

The largest buyer was T. Rowe Price Associates, adding an estimated $11.3M. The largest seller was Two Sigma Investments, cutting an estimated $3.3M.
